Appointment of a Service Provider for the Design and Reconstruction (turnkey) of Shop Nos 1, 2, 3 & 4 at Idfc Jozini Shopping Centre in the Kwazulu-natal Province.

Tender Number: RFP13/26
Department: Kwa-Zulu Natal - Ithala Development Finance Corporation
Tender Type: Request for Bid(Open-Tender)
Province: KwaZulu-Natal
Closing Date: Wednesday, 15 July 2026 - 11:00
Place where goods, works or services are required: 29 Canal Quay Road, Point Waterfront - Point Waterfront - Durban - 4000
Special Conditions: N/A
ENQUIRIES:
Contact Person: Supply Chain Management
Email: [email protected]
Telephone number: 031-907-8703
FAX Number: N/A
BRIEFING SESSION:
Is there a briefing session?: Yes Is it compulsory? Yes
Briefing Date and Time: Thursday, 02 July 2026 - 10:00
Briefing Venue: IDFC Jozini Shopping Centre, 12 Main Street, Jozini, 3969

Tender Summary

Objectives

The primary objective of this tender is to appoint a qualified service provider to design and reconstruct Shop Nos 1, 2, 3 & 4 at IDFC Jozini Shopping Centre, which were damaged by fire. The project aims to restore the shops to a safe, compliant, and functional condition, incorporating modern standards, improved resilience, and ensuring aesthetic harmony with the existing shopping centre. Additionally, the project seeks to contribute to local economic regeneration, job creation, and enhanced community service delivery in the Jozini area.

Scope

The scope of work includes:

  • Assessment of fire damage, including structural, electrical, mechanical, and hazard analysis.
  • Demolition of unsafe structures and site clearance.
  • Design development, including architectural, structural, electrical, mechanical, and fire protection systems, aligned with existing designs and standards.
  • Reconstruction of the damaged structures, including foundations, walls, roofing, and building envelope.
  • Installation of electrical, plumbing, HVAC, and fire safety systems.
  • Implementation of fire safety and risk mitigation measures.
  • Quality assurance, project management, testing, commissioning, and handover.
  • Compliance with statutory approvals, environmental and health regulations, and building standards.

The project duration is approximately 12 months, covering design, approval, procurement, construction, and handover phases.

Technical Requirements

  • Conduct detailed structural and fire damage assessments.
  • Ensure compliance with National Building Regulations, South African Bureau of Standards, municipal approvals, and environmental standards.
  • Design and implement fire detection, alarm, and suppression systems with fire-resistant materials and proper compartmentalisation.
  • Rebuild structural elements, restore building envelope, and install necessary systems to meet safety and functional standards.
  • Engage qualified professionals including project managers, architects, engineers, and safety officers, all with relevant registration and experience.
  • Ensure all construction work matches the existing shopping centre’s aesthetic and architectural detailing.
  • Implement health and safety management in line with Occupational Health and Safety Act.
  • Test and commission all systems before handover, providing occupancy certificates and final completion documentation.

Skills Requirements

  • Project management expertise with a certified Project Manager registered with the South African Council for Project and Construction Management Profession.
  • Architectural design skills with experience in design and build projects of similar scope and scale.
  • Structural, electrical, mechanical, and civil engineering professionals registered with relevant councils (ECSA, SACPCMP, SACQSP) with at least 5 years of relevant experience.
  • Construction team including a Construction Manager (NQF 6 or higher), Site Foreman, and Supervisors with relevant registration and over 5 years of experience.
  • Health and Safety officers with SACPCMP registration and relevant experience.
  • Specialist contractors for fire safety, HVAC, electrical, plumbing, and structural works, all with appropriate registration and experience.
  • Ability to work collaboratively with local contractors and service providers, ensuring skills transfer and local labour participation where possible.
  • Demonstrated experience in delivering turnkey construction projects within budget and timeframe, with references for projects exceeding R10 million.
